Resumo: Introduction: Pregnancy is a special moment in a woman’s life, marked by several transformations physical, hormonal and psychological; those demand attention during the pre-natal care. In this phase, an approach towards the development of health care becomes more favorable due to the fact that the pregnant is willing to acquire some knowledge, change habits and improve her health practices to her own benefit along with her baby’s. For this reason, women must be informed about the importance of keeping a good dental health during pregnancy, as well as being instructed on how to properly take care of her kids' dental health in the future. Some pieces of evidence suggest that the lack of attention to dental health during pregnancy may cause negative repercussions such as pre-eclampsia, premature birth and low birth weight. Taking this into consideration, it becomes essential that professionals from the health area work together, with the purpose of clarifying doubts and refer women to carry out the dental pre-natal care. General objective: Build a Distance Learning training program effective to help professionals of the health area to understand the importance of pre-natal dental care. Specifics : (1) Identify the factors involved in the usage of dental services in the gestational and pre-gestational moments; (2) Understand the perception of professionals of the health area in health centers (UBS - from the Brazilian abbreviation) and in the Brazilian project Family Health Strategy (ESF - from the Brazilian abbreviation) about the pre-natal dental care, before and after the training program. Methodology: In order to achieve the first specific objective, a cross-sectional study was developed in a random group of 256 expecting women who were receiving pre-natal care in the public system in the city of Santa Maria, south of Brazil. Through a questionnaire the usage of dental service by pregnant women in the last 12 months was collected, altogether with socioeconomical, psychosocial, behavioral and mouth health. The dental anxiety was evaluated through the Brazilian version of the Dental Anxiety Scale (DAS). To the study, the dental services used in the last year, as well as their source (public or private) were evaluated. Models of Poisson regression with robust variance were applied to evaluate the connections between the predictor variables and the outcome through a hierarchical approach. The results were presented in the Prevalence Ratio (PR) and 95% Confidence Interval (95% CI). To carry out the second specific objective, aligned with the general objective proposed, a training program was created to instruct the professionals involved with pre-natal care in UBSs and ESFs in the city of Santa Maria/RS about the importance of dental pre-natal care for both mother and baby. To elaborate the training program, technology focused on distance learning was applied through a Moodle platform, using several resources, such as video classes, availability of additional material and evaluations of the discussed topics. The subjects of the training program also answered a survey before and after the course in order to evaluate how the program influenced their knowledge about the topic and to better comprehend the dynamics of referring pregnant patients to the dental surgeon services. Results: Regarding the cross-sectional study, 256 pregnant patients were evaluated; 255 of those answered the question related to the use of services in the last 12 months. The average 13 age of those patients was 25,42 (SD 6,57) years old. Pregnant women who presented high dental anxiety had 47% less prevalence in the use of dental services in the last 12 months (PR 1,47; 95% IC 1,04 – 2,07). The ones with low schooling, less frequent teeth brushing and who evaluated their own dental health as bad or appalling have also made less frequent use of dental services. In regarding to the type of this dental care, women with less than 8 years of schooling, in a lower socioeconomical group and who did not attend to the pregnancy group were more susceptible to use the public health system. In what comes to the results of the study used to answer the second specific objective of this thesis, the group of subjects was composed by 38 professionals - two physicians, three nurses, nine community health agents (ACS – from the Brazilian abbreviation), eight nursing technicians, three receptionists, one dental health care assistant - from the UBSs and ESFs in the region of Santa Maria – RS. The average age was 45 years old (minimal age being 24 and maximum 60), thirty-two participants were female and six were male. Through the initial survey it was observed that the majority of the participants reported having little or no knowledge in regarding to the approached topic, what seems to be reflected in the deficiency related to the process of referring pregnant patients to the dental pre-natal care. After the training program, the subjects demonstrated to be more secure and well biased to discuss the topic and account for the importance of pregnant patients having regular follow ups with a dental surgeon, as motivation during this period as well as to prevent diseases and complications for the woman’s and baby’s health. Thus, the training program managed to clarify, instruct and motivate those professionals to encourage pregnant patients to carry out with the dental pre-natal care, demystifying possible misbelieves and myths regarding this service. Final considerations: The first study of this thesis has shown a reduced use of dental services during the pre-gestational and gestational periods, being propellant to the construction of professional training in regarding to the importance of dental services during the pre-natal care to the professionals of health centers (UBSs) and the Family Health Strategy project (ESFs). To estimate the values of the training program to the service, a second study was conducted, in which it was possible to verify the perception of the health team before and after it was carried out. It is believed that an interdisciplinary approach is one of the most meaningful ways to improve the use of dental services by pregnant women, reverberating positively in their own health and also their babies’. Technical product: The product of this research was a training program, through distance learning, considered a meaningful educational material to clarify, instruct and demystifying issues related to pre-natal dental care. By the same token, reinforce its importance to professionals of UBSs and ESFs, stimulating them to refer pregnant patients to dental surgeons. It’s crucial to stress how effortless it can be applied in different cities, considering it can be accessed anywhere in conjunction with its meaningfulness in the health of the mother-baby binomial.
